Quiche is a French dish that is an open pie with filling. It is served both hot and cold. Usually the baking form is round, the base is made of shortcrust pastry, on top of which the filling and filling are distributed. The second name of the pie is quiche Laurent. It was so named for its origin in the Lorraine region of France. There are many versions of baking. Quiche with broccoli and feta cheese is one of the most common.
